Homeomorphisms are the isomorphisms in the category of topological spaces —that is, they are the mappings that preserve all the topological properties of a given space Two spaces with a homeomorphism between them are called homeomorphic, and from a topological viewpoint they are the same

f is said to be a homeomorphism if f is continuous and its inverse f 1 is continuous In this case we say that (X; T ) and (Y; U) are homeomorphic, and write (X; T ) ' (Y; U), or more often simply X ' Y if the topologies are understood from context

In general topology, a homeomorphism is a map between spaces that preserves all topological properties Intuitively, given some sort of geometric object, a topological property is a property of the object that remains unchanged after the object has been stretched or deformed in some way
